TCP/IP Configuration

Introduction

This section contains instructions for configuring
the TCP/IP protocol for both Windows and
Macintosh operating systems.

Configuring the TCP/IP Protocol for Windows 95/98/ME

Note:

You need to have either an Ethernet

Network Interface Card (NIC) with the TCP/IP
communications protocol installed on your system,
or a USB network interface, before you install your
cable modem.

Follow these steps to install and configure the
TCP/IP protocol for Windows 95/98.

1. Click Start, select Settings, and choose Control

Panel

. The Control Panel window appears.

2. In the Control Panel window, double-click the

Network

icon. A list of installed network

components appears.

3. Under the Configuration tab, read the list of

installed network components to verify your
PC contains the TCP/IP protocol.

4.

Does your PC have the TCP/IP protocol?

• If yes, go to step 8.
• If no, click Add.

5. Click Protocol, and then click Add.

6. In the Manufacturers list, click Microsoft.

7. In the Network Protocols list, scroll to and click

TCP/IP

, and then click OK.

8. Scroll to and click the TCP/IP Ethernet Adapter

protocol, and then click Properties.

9. Click the IP Address tab, and then select Obtain

an IP address automatically

.

10. Click the Gateway tab and verify that these

fields are empty. If they are not empty, highlight
and delete all information from the fields.

11. Click the DNS Configuration tab; then,

select Disable DNS.

12. Click OK. The Copying Files... window appears.
